Abstract EN
The current protozoal study was intended to explore the presence and the evolutionary history of Theileria spp in ticks that infecte 150 out of 200 cows in Al-Diwaniyah City, Iraq.
For these purposes, 10 ticks were collected from each cow, identified morphologically, and crushed for extract Theileria-based DNA from the tick tissues.
The extracted DNA was examined by polymerase chain reaction (PCR) technique for molecularly identificationusing special primer of 18S rRNAgene.
The PCR-targeted products of the 18S rRNA gene were subjected to sequencing for further confirmation of the diagnosis of the Theileria spp.
The results revealed 2 distinct sequenced protozoa, SP1 and SP2.
After performing database searching and comparing the current 2 isolates to some regional and global species, the results showed that the SP1 is closely related to Theileria lestoquardi, KP342263.1 and the SP2 is closely related to Theileria annulata, MF287951.1.
The study reveals important information about the evolutionary history of these protozoa in Al-Diwaniyah City, Iraq.
